Wildfire Defense Systems, Inc. ("WDS") is a Qualified Insurance Resource (QIR) operating the largest private sector wildfire service in the nation, encompassing a 22‑state service area and specializing in wildfire education, loss prevention, and wildfire response services. Qualified Insurance Resources are defined as NWCG qualified or equivalent, wildland engines, tenders, hand crews, fire/liaison officers, and personnel working for or contracted by an insurance company with a mission to mitigate impacts on insured structures threatened by wildfire. WDS holds contracts with insurance companies to provide wildfire loss prevention services. WDS fields experienced, highly trained, safety‑focused wildfire officers and fire personnel that hold a wide range of Federal Wildfire Incident Command position classifications necessary to meet or exceed all federal wildfire operation standards and codes including all requirements of the National Wildfire Coordinating Group (NWCG) or equivalent. WDS is capable of providing more than 180 wildland engines and hundreds of fire personnel and support personnel. WDS has served large and small insurance clients since 2008.

Purpose and Scope of Position As a payroll administrator, you play a crucial role in ensuring that all employees within our organization are compensated accurately and on time. Your primary responsibilities include managing payroll systems, calculating wages, processing tax deductions, and maintaining comprehensive payroll records. You will also handle employee inquiries related to payroll, ensure compliance with federal and state regulations, and prepare detailed payroll reports for management. This role requires strong numerical skills, attention to detail, and proficiency with payroll software. By efficiently managing these tasks, you will help maintain organizational compliance and employee satisfaction.
Duties and Responsibilities:
Payroll submission
Timecard review
Entering deduction changes and additional earnings
Working with employee and managers to correct and approve missing/incorrect items
Review check register
Processing check corrections
Submit payroll accurately and on time
Save reports and disperse information appropriately
Handle new employee orientation and additional employee training
Handle payroll mail
Handle payroll emails
Assist in data collection and entry
Handle 401K processes
Track new hires/rehires/returners on payroll new hire spreadsheet for eligibility accuracy
Track employee eligibility requirements
Enroll eligible employees on American Funds
Add safe harbor contribution to eligible employee’s payroll software profiles
Notify newly eligible employees of plan info and docs
Review and approve eligible employees’ contribution change requests
Audit safe harbor contributions during payroll runs
Deposit employee contributions in American Funds
Send contribution breakdowns to Accounting for G/L processing
Answer employee questions and provide necessary documentation
Workers’ Compensation wage reporting
Hartford PFML for required states
SOC code audits for required states
Assist with benefit deductions
Assist with review of special group deduction limits
Coordinate manager payroll and HRIS software training
